Ink Essential blog is maintained by Tashi, creator of InkEssential.com Tashi is an Englishman who started on his path in the arts and meditation at the tender age of 11. After he finished his formal art degree training, he became a Buddhist monk in the Tibetan Karma Kagyu order. For the next 17 years he studied under a Tibetan master of arts called Sherab Palden Beru, apprenticing in the elaborate art of temple decoration and Tibetan calligraphy.
In response to an ever increasing interest in Tibetan scripts, ancient Sanskrit, Mantras and Tibetan floral designs, this website is dedicated to providing advice and the opportunity to commission the artist Tashi Mannox for personally created art work designs for the skin. The International Society of Tibetology (IST) is a non-profit organization committed to the preservation of Tibetan culture and Buddhism. Our website at www.tibetology.org provides explanations of Buddhist practices, lineage masters, history, art, and music. A forum for discussion and sharing of information is given as well as links to ongoing and future projects concerning the development of Tibetan culture and religion from around the world.
